Then I tried China King in Cary. They are hands down better than the rest. Their food is staple Chinese American fare, but they do a great job with it.
My two greatest complaints about Chinese takeout is that the meat is often rubbery and the food is fatty/greasy. Not so with China King! Their food is always appealing and appetizing. Plenty of meat in with the veggies, and it is cooked perfectly every time. Seasoning is light, which I like.
Service is always fast, or at least reasonable, not matter when I phone in a delivery order. Usually 30 minutes. Once on a Friday at 6:00 it was 45 minutes, even when traffic was at a standstill out on 440. The food was still hot. I have never gotten cold food from them.
On their online order menu, they provide a box where you can type in special instructions. I use this to ask for the broccoli to be cooked until it is firm and no longer crunchy, and for the pepper and onion dishes to be more onion and less peppers. They always do as I ask.
Their food prices are less expensive than Golden Dragon and comparable with all the other restaurants I have tried, and for the convenience and the amount of food they deliver in each meal, I think their pricing is absolutely fair and reasonable.
